Klaas Visser is a scholar working on Environmental Engineering, Aerospace Engineering and Electrical and Electronic Engineering. According to data from OpenAlex, Klaas Visser has authored 55 papers receiving a total of 2.0k indexed citations (citations by other indexed papers that have themselves been cited), including 26 papers in Environmental Engineering, 13 papers in Aerospace Engineering and 13 papers in Electrical and Electronic Engineering. Recurrent topics in Klaas Visser’s work include Maritime Transport Emissions and Efficiency (26 papers), Spacecraft and Cryogenic Technologies (10 papers) and Advancements in Solid Oxide Fuel Cells (8 papers). Klaas Visser is often cited by papers focused on Maritime Transport Emissions and Efficiency (26 papers), Spacecraft and Cryogenic Technologies (10 papers) and Advancements in Solid Oxide Fuel Cells (8 papers). Klaas Visser collaborates with scholars based in The Netherlands, China and Australia. Klaas Visser's co-authors include Lindert van Biert, P.V. Aravind, Milinko Godjevac, Rinze Geertsma, Rudy R. Negenborn, J.J. Hopman, P De Vos, Douwe Stapersma, Theo Woudstra and Yu Ding and has published in prestigious journals such as Journal of the American College of Cardiology, Journal of Power Sources and Applied Energy.
